Special Features
Barry Pohio is the owner and he also owns Armourdene Rest Home, just 1 Km away. He has active involvement in the home and brings with him many years of business experience and, more recently, working with older people. Through Armourdene Barry has a good understanding of the support services that are available in the community and in residential care. In offering care at Alphacare Riverview Barry believes that the residents have a right to good quality care that not only meets their needs but their desires too and that staff should be happy and well paid. He believes this generation deserve all the care they can get, and more.

Since his arrival Barry and his team have worked hard with the staff to achieve certification. Renovations of the interior, the exterior and gardens have been undertaken and the home looks warm and inviting. Staffing levels have been increased, as have the hours of the Activities Co-ordinator. More variety has also been bought into the menu. A registered nurse is on duty or on call all day, every day, including weekends. We share activities and outings with our Armourdene residents from time to time.

Whilst Alphacare Riverview is located in a quiet suburban street overlooking the Waikato River it is also very close to the central business area and city centre so we get the best of both worlds. The home has several small wings of resident’s rooms that radiate from the central living area. There are wide views across the river from a large, sunny deck that opens from the lounge. A number of the rooms also have similar lovely views and doors opening onto the deck. A deck at the front of the building captures the morning sun.

Barry and the staff welcome visitors. You are welcome to come and see our home in operation and to perhaps come for a meal or join in our activity programme.

Interests And Activities

Our activities co-ordinator has a very 'bubbly' happy, outgoing manner. She also has wonderful skills of listening attentively, seeing a need when it emerges, responding in a sensitive manner and giving time to those who need it.

Our activity programme, whilst set to some extent (at residents request) has considerable input by the residents during their monthly meetings. It is residents choice if they are involved in the structured progamme or whether they wish to do things individually. Our Activites staff give all resients time to ensure that letter gets written or a quiet chat time is provided, it is up to the resident to do as they wish.

Birthdays of our residents are important and special therefore we celebrate their birthdays individaully on the actual day with a special afternoon tea, a birthday cake and gift.

Bingo and Board Games are regular and one resident entertains regularly as our Pianist.

Entertainers are brought in and Happy Hour is every Friday. We share a Minibus with Armourdene. This also helps for Shopping trips., Activity programme
